Identifying Credible Online Retailers
Purchasing gold online entails a trust factor that cannot be underestimated. Identifying reputable dealers is the first step in ensuring safe transactions. Buyers should conduct thorough research before committing to any purchases. Key indicators of a credible retailer include:
Established Reputation: Choose dealers with a long-standing presence in the industry and positive reviews from previous customers. Online forums, consumer advocacy websites, and social media can provide insights into the experiences of other buyers. Transparency: A trustworthy dealer will provide clear information regarding prices, product descriptions, and transaction policies. They should have easily accessible contact information and excellent customer service. Certification and Authenticity: Look for sellers who provide proof of authenticity for their gold products. Certifications from respected organizations, such as the London Bullion Market Association (LBMA), assure buyers of the purity and quality of the gold offered. Secure Payment Options: Credible retailers will offer secure payment methods. Buyers should ensure that platforms use encryption technology to protect personal and financial data during transactions. Return Policy: Reputable sellers will have a transparent return policy, allowing buyers to return products that do not meet their satisfaction as per stipulated guidelines. Understanding Pricing Dynamics
Online platforms make it easy to compare prices across different retailers, a feature that significantly benefits buyers. However, understanding the factors that influence gold pricing is crucial. Gold prices can fluctuate based on market trends influenced by geopolitical events, inflation rates, and currency values. Tools such as live price charts, which many reputable sellers provide, can help buyers stay informed about current market conditions.Additionally, buyers should be wary of prices that seem too good to be true. While competitive pricing is an attractive feature, exceedingly low prices may indicate counterfeit products or scams. Always approach deals that appear suspicious with caution.
Ensuring Security During Transactions
The actual buying process is a critical phase that demands attention to detail. When buying gold online, buyers should prioritize their security and privacy. Here are some recommended practices for safe online transactions:
Secure Internet Connection: Ensure that the transaction occurs over a secure internet connection. Avoid making purchases on public Wi-Fi networks where data can be intercepted. Two-Factor Authentication: Enable two-factor authentication if the retailer offers it, adding an extra layer of security to the buyer's account. Payment Method Selection: Using credit cards or PayPal often provides additional consumer protection against fraudulent transactions compared to wire transfers or direct bank payments. Receipt and Documentation: After making a purchase, buyers should ensure they receive confirmation emails detailing the transaction and product specifications.
